Hi there,
To be perfectly honest, I think the poll is kind of pointless. No offence here, but given the fact that we all cannot be like average_joe to build up such a huge amount of CIEMs for comparison, at this point I'd say we are just telling you what we want/like personally. And given the usual YMMV, huge chance that it might not do the trick for you. Essentially, aside from sound quality, it boils down to less noticeable but equally important other factors such as comfort, build quality, longevity, customer services...etc. And let's face it: spending 1/6 of that 2000 bucks on a good portable amp will bring substantial gains in sound quality that might not even be realised by splurging on a much more "superior" pair of customs than what you're planning to get. After all, do you have the equipments it takes to appreciate the superiority in sound quality? $100 on a portable amp at this level sounds like a joke to me. No offence.
And if I have to chime in my opinion, I'd say that the Heir Audio 8.A with the 25% discount sounds hard to miss with all the customisation options, even though here in the UK I'd rather pick the ACS T1 Live! due to Boots 15% offer and the fact that I have to deal with overseas customs import/duty. The 8.A sounds more to your liking the most out of the three, and given the fact that you'll have around $300 to spare on an amp (or if possible, I suggest some one-in-all solutions like the DX100 or C4 DAP), it's hard to imagine you not emerging a winner.

It's a bad poll because you are trying to pick between three customs that have different tunings for different audiences (the T1 is a stage monitor, for example, the others aren't). If you don't know what sound you want, then any custom will be a toss-up for you.
Customs don't sound their best without an amp and no, you are wrong that pricier amps are larger. There are high-end portable amps that are very small. Look at the Apex Glacier for example.
I think the basic problem is that you haven't really done your homework and posting a lot isn't the same and thinking for yourself. Figure out the sound you want and buy the custom that fits that. Buy a Glacier or something similar so the custom you want will sound its best.

It looks like the race is between the UM Miracle and the Heir 8.A. Let me be clear, I've never heard a UM product, but I know many (whose hearing tendencies I know well) that have, and the Miracle doesn't seem to be the type of signature you're looking for, because I rarely, if ever see the words "rich, warm, organic and natural" being used to describe the Miracle. I'm sure it's a fine product, as I know quite a few members who really like it, but if you look at what people say about the 8.A, "rich, warm, organic and natural" are words often thrown around. The other thing is that UM doesn't have as good a track record with customer service. They have a good reputation because they've been discussed in the forums longer, but I've heard some pretty bad stories about their messing up orders, delaying orders, or poor response times that tend to get swept under the rug. On the other hand, I've been highly impressed by the level of service that Heir provides. Even though their sample size is smaller (as the company is newer), they've been highly impressive about delivering prompt, high quality service. If there's a problem, you can be sure they'll do everything in their power to make it right. To my understanding, they also have more native or fluent English speakers on their staff. Along with the 2-year warranty and owner transfer thing, you're looking at something that's a great value.
It sounds like I'm a Heir fanboy, but that's really not the case. It's merely my conclusion from the interaction I've had with UM (I've had long exchanges with them, both with Stephen Guo and Matt of UMAus) and with the folks at Heir. Yes, I've heard more of Heir's products, but I've been known to speak critically about certain things about their stuff as well. For example, I'm not the biggest fan of the Otterbox case they include, the cleaning tool, and at times, their distribution and shipping (though they've gotten better in this aspect). Then again, you'll run into these same problems with UM as well -- IIRC, they don't include a protective case, only a decorative one, and distribution from China is going to be an issue no matter what if you live in the US. In the US, the one company that has consistently had a great track record for customer service is Ultimate Ears (not JH, nor any other US-based company; not sure about Westone).
